Logo
Games Deal Radar
EN
ES

KARMORA

Gallery

KARMORA Screenshot 1
KARMORA Screenshot 2
KARMORA Screenshot 3
KARMORA Screenshot 4

About this Game

Step into a mysterious universe where you hold the power to control and customise everything you desire.